I love beet greens. They're one of my favourite things to eat, even more than the beets themselves. For this appetizer, they're paired with sweet fall apple, and topped with crunchy walnuts and a drizzle of really good balsamic. Super simple yet totally delicious.

Ingredients and spices that need to be Make ready to make Sauteed beet greens with apple, walnuts, and balsamic:

  1. Leaves from 1 bundle of beets (about 1 cup, chopped), destemmed
  2. 1/4 cup chopped walnuts
  3. 1/4 cup Granny Smith apples, cored and cut into small cubes
  4. 1 tbsp shallot, finely sliced
  5. 1 clove garlic, finely sliced
  6. 2 tbsp high-quality aged balsamic vinegar

Instructions to make to make Sauteed beet greens with apple, walnuts, and balsamic

  1. Wash the beet greens well and pat them dry. For the larger leaves, remove the tough central stems. Chop the leaves into bite-sized strips.
  2. Put a medium pan on medium heat. Add the walnuts and fry for 1 minute to toast them lightly. Don't let the nuts burn. Remove the nuts to a bowl and wipe the pan clean.
  3. Turn the heat up to medium-high and add a splash of veg oil to the pan. Add the apples and fry for 1 to 2 minutes until they're golden brown and slightly softened.
  4. Add the shallot and garlic to the pan. Continue frying for 1 minute until fragrant, then add the beet greens. Add a pinch of salt and a few grinds of pepper, and saute for 2 to 3 minutes. Remove everything to a plate. Sprinkle the toasted walnuts on top and drizzle with the balsamic.
